Preston Howard, Jr., P.E., Director A4 reel E3 F= F1 May 9, 1995 Montgomery County DEM Project # 95457 APPROVAL of 401 Water Quality Certification Ms. Mary Northington, Secretary Holiday Shores Route 1, Box HS-5 Troy, N.C. 27371 FILE COW I Dear Ms. Northington: You have our approval to place fill material in 0.003 acres of wetlands or waters for the purpose of rebuilding a boat dock fishing pier at your property on Lake Tillery, as you described in your application dated 2 May 1995. After reviewing your application, we have decided that this fill is covered by General Water Quality Certification Number 2674. This certification allows you to use General Permit Number 030 when it is issued by the Corps of Engineers. This approval is only valid for the purpose and design that you described in your application. If you change your project, you must notify us and you may be required to send us a new application. For this approval to be valid, you must follow the conditions listed in the attached certification. In addition; you should get any other federal, state or local permits before you go ahead with your project. If you do not accept any of the conditions of this certification, you may ask for an adjudicatory hearing. You must act within 30 days of the date that you receive this letter. To ask for a hearing, send a written petition which conforms to Chapter 150B of the North Carolina General Stamtes to the Office of Administrative Hearings, P.O. Box 27447, Raleigh, N.C. 27611-7447. This certification and its conditions are final and binding unless you ask for a hearing. This letter completes the review of the Division of Environmental Management under Section 401 of the Clean Water Act.
